#define UNICODE
#include <windows.h>
#include <wchar.h>
#include <stdio.h>

WCHAR   ExportTag[] = L"Export Version";
WCHAR   DomesticTag[] = L"US/Canada Only, Not for Export";
WCHAR   OldDomesticTag[] = L"Domestic Use Only";
DWORD   DefLang = 0x04b00409;

#define BINARY_TYPE_UNKNOWN         0
#define BINARY_TYPE_CONTROLLED      1
#define BINARY_TYPE_OPEN            2
#define BINARY_TYPE_CONTROLLED_OLD  3


BOOL
CheckIfControlled(
    LPWSTR  Path,
    DWORD   Flags)
{
    PUCHAR  pData;
    DWORD   cbData;
    DWORD   Zero;
    PWSTR   Description;
    WCHAR   ValueTag[64];
    PDWORD  pdwTranslation;
    DWORD   uLen;

    cbData = GetFileVersionInfoSize( Path, &Zero );

    if ( cbData == 0 )
    {
        return( BINARY_TYPE_UNKNOWN );
    }

    pData = LocalAlloc( LMEM_FIXED | LMEM_ZEROINIT, cbData );

    if ( !pData )
    {
        return( BINARY_TYPE_UNKNOWN );
    }

    if ( ! GetFileVersionInfo( Path, 0, cbData, pData ) )
    {
        LocalFree( pData );
        return( BINARY_TYPE_UNKNOWN );
    }

    if(!VerQueryValue(pData, L"\\VarFileInfo\\Translation", &pdwTranslation, &uLen))
    {
        pdwTranslation = &DefLang;

        uLen = sizeof(DWORD);
    }

    swprintf( ValueTag, L"\\StringFileInfo\\%04x%04x\\FileDescription",
                LOWORD( *pdwTranslation ), HIWORD( *pdwTranslation ) );

    // L"\\StringFileInfo\\040904b0\\FileDescription",
    if (VerQueryValue(  pData,
                        ValueTag,
                        &Description,
                        &cbData ) )
    {
        if (wcsstr( Description, DomesticTag ) )
        {
            LocalFree( pData );
            return( BINARY_TYPE_CONTROLLED );
        }

        if (wcsstr( Description, OldDomesticTag ) )
        {
            LocalFree( pData );
            return( BINARY_TYPE_CONTROLLED_OLD );
        }

        if ( wcsstr( Description, ExportTag ) )
        {
            LocalFree( pData );

            return( BINARY_TYPE_OPEN );
        }

        LocalFree( pData );

        return( BINARY_TYPE_UNKNOWN );

    }

    return( BINARY_TYPE_UNKNOWN );

}
